Common Rodent Control Myths



You might have listened to that cheese is the most effective lure for catching rats, however in reality, this is just one of the typical rodent control misconceptions. Unlike popular belief, rodents aren't specifically attracted to cheese. They've an even more substantial preference for foods high in sugar and fat, such as fruits, nuts, and grains. Utilizing these kinds of baits can be more reliable in tempting rats into traps.

An additional widespread misconception is that pet cats are the best solution for rodent control. The Reality About Rat Repellents



Unlike common belief, lots of rodent repellents on the market may not be as reliable as advertised in controlling rodent populations. While these items assert to keep rats at bay, the reality is that rats can promptly adjust to the aromas and sounds created by the majority of repellents.

Likewise, pepper mint oil and other natural repellents might only give short-term alleviation, as rodents can eventually disregard and even come to be attracted to these scents.

It's vital to approach rodent control with a thorough strategy that exceeds depending exclusively on repellents. Securing access points, minimizing accessibility to food and water sources, and maintaining sanitation are critical steps in protecting against infestations. By incorporating these techniques with professional bug control solutions when required, you can efficiently handle rodent populaces in your house or organization. Keep in mind, prevention is type in maintaining rodents at bay.

Debunking Rat Extermination Methods



Many rodent extermination techniques marketed as quick fixes typically fall short in successfully removing rodent populations. While these techniques might appear appealing as a result of their simplicity or affordable, it's important to recognize their limitations to take on rodent invasions effectively.

- ** Glue Traps **: Though typically made use of, glue traps can trigger distress to rats without guaranteeing their quick discontinuation.

- ** Ultrasonic Gadgets **: Despite cases of discharging sounds to fend off rodents, researches show restricted efficiency in driving them away.

- ** Poisonous substance Lures **: While poison baits can eliminate rodents, they may additionally posture threats to animals or youngsters if incorrectly managed.

- ** Snap Traps **: Snap traps are more humane than some approaches yet might not resolve the origin of the invasion.



- ** Smoke Bombs **: Smoke bombs can be hazardous and may not get to all locations where rodents are present, leaving some untouched.

Understanding the subtleties of these extermination approaches can aid you make informed choices to efficiently manage rodent problems in your house.
